How much does it cost to move from Bridgeport to Lansing?

On average, moving companies in Connecticut charge about per hour. Consider these typical rates for a full-service moving company, moving container, or rental truck:

Move size Moving company Moving container Rental
truck
Studio / 1 bedroom $1,109 – $3,785 $714 – $1,713 $504 – $957
2 – 3 bedrooms $2,102 – $5,286 $1,353 – $2,731 $572 – $1,147
4+ bedrooms $3,417 – $6,912 $1,741 – $3,349 $694 – $1,348
*Estimated cost ranges for a 737-mile move from Bridgeport to Lansing are shown here using moveBuddha data as of Nov 07, 2025. We compile thousands of verified price points from nationwide movers and update the dataset monthly to account for seasonal patterns and broader market trends. Your total may differ depending on volume, selected services, parking/access limitations, fuel prices, and timing. Comparing quotes from multiple moving companies is the best way to pinpoint a precise price.

Cost to hire movers from Bridgeport to Lansing

When planning a move to Lansing from Bridgeport, for a studio or one-bedroom, you’ll likely pay between $1,109 and $3,785. If you have a two- or three-bedroom home, expect costs to fall somewhere between $2,102 and $5,286 for the same journey. Moving four or five bedrooms? Typical prices range from $3,417 to $6,912.

Cost of moving containers from Bridgeport to Lansing

When you’re heading from Bridgeport to Lansing, and you’re only moving a few items, you can expect to spend between $714 and $1,713. For a two- or three-bedroom place, prices usually fall between $1,353 and $2,731. If you’re packing up a large home with four or more bedrooms, the cost can range from $1,741 to $3,349. Want more details? Check out our complete PODS cost guide.

Explore the top budget-friendly moving container companies to make your move from Connecticut easier and more affordable.

Cost of moving truck rentals from Bridgeport to Lansing

A moving rental truck from Bridgeport to Lansing is generally the cheapest option, but it requires you to do all of the driving and labor.

Moving a studio or one-bedroom apartment in a rental truck will cost around $504 to $957. A two to three-bedroom move will cost $572 to $1,147, and moving a home with four or more bedrooms from Bridgeport to Lansing costs around $694 to $1,348.

These quotes include the estimated fuel cost.

What to know before moving from Bridgeport to Lansing

Many movers find Lansing easier on the wallet than Bridgeport – roughly 27% less for singles and 18% less for families.

Monthly basics average $1,595 for one person in Lansing versus $2,191 in Bridgeport. For a family of four, it’s $4,199 compared with $5,126.

See the cost breakdown below to pinpoint where the savings add up:

Bridgeport Lansing
Average 1 BR rent $2,000 $901
Average 3 BR rent $2,795 $1,775
Average home value $334,700 $148,542
Average income (per capita) $50,597 $64,729
Cost of living (single) $2,191 $1,595
Cost of living (family of four) $5,126 $4,199
Unemployment rate 13.2% 7.4%
Sales tax 6.35% 6.0%
State income tax 3.0% 4.25%
  • Rent is about 46% less expensive in Lansing than in Bridgeport, so you will have more cash on hand each month.
  • Expect your mortgage payments to be easier on the wallet, as home prices are around 56% cheaper in Lansing than in Bridgeport.
  • Here’s some fantastic news, the average income is approximately 28% greater in Lansing than in Bridgeport, offering more potential for savings or investments each month.
  • Expect to spend less on everyday needs such as food, fuel, and utilities in Lansing. The cost of living for a single person there is 27% below that of Bridgeport.
  • A move to Lansing can offer your family a more affordable lifestyle, with savings on everyday costs such as utilities, groceries, and transport. The cost of living for a family is 18% lower compared to Bridgeport.
  • Lansing has a lower unemployment rate than Bridgeport by about 44%. This signals a stronger job market and healthier local economy, both promising indicators for someone relocating.
  • Sales taxes are 6% cheaper in Lansing compared to Bridgeport. This could significantly slash costs for families or individuals with higher spending on taxable necessities.
  • Income taxes are 42% more in Michigan than in Connecticut. This increase in state taxes means you will retain less of your earnings, impacting your disposable income.

Other things to consider for your Bridgeport to Lansing move

  • HOA rules: Costs across Bridgeport and Lansing are largely aligned, so your monthly budget shouldn’t shift much after the move.
  • Elevator reservation: If your building has an elevator you’ll want to check on how to reserve it for move day.
  • Truck parking permits: Many cities require special permits for parking large moving trucks. Check in advance to see if one is needed for your move.
  • State licensing: The agency regulating local and intrastate household goods movers in Michigan is the Michigan Public Service Commission (MPSC). State regulation and oversight activities include commercial vehicle registration and safety compliance, review of published tariff rates, licensing, and consumer protection efforts. Ensure the company you choose is licensed to handle your move.
  • State regulator: To confirm a moving company’s license in Michigan, visit the state’s public utilities commission.
  • Moving Permits: Moving permits aren’t typically required in Michigan, but always confirm with local authorities to avoid surprises.
  • Change of address: You can set an official move date on the form and this way all of your mail will get properly forwarded to Lansing. Get started here.
  • Moving company insurance: Each state has its own requirements for the level of insurance moving companies must carry. In Alabama, Massachusetts, and Michigan, choose the economical option of Released Value Protection, provided by movers at no extra cost. However, it offers minimal coverage at 60 cents per pound per article. For comprehensive coverage of your items’ full value, consult with your moving company for alternatives or explore third-party insurance providers.

Things to do in Lansing

With your move to Michigan complete, you can dive right into experiencing Lansing. From cultural attractions to outdoor adventures, you’ll never run out of things to do:

  • Arts and culture: Lansing is home to museums and cultural arts centers like the Michigan History Center, Impression 5 Science Center, and R.E. Olds Transportation Museum.
  • Outdoor recreation: The city’s Woldumar Nature Center, Potter Park Zoo, Hawk Island Park, and River Trail — among other spots — perfect for hiking, biking, or simply soaking up the outdoors.
  • Sports: Experience the energy of a live game and back the home team at an Lansing Lugnuts (Baseball) game.

When is the best time to move from Bridgeport to Lansing?

If you’re flexible with timing, spring and fall are great seasons to move from Bridgeport to Lansing. You’ll dodge the heat, the crowds, and the higher moving costs typical of peak season in Bridgeport.

When is the cheapest time to move from Bridgeport to Lansing?

Want to save on your move from Bridgeport to Lansing? Consider scheduling it in winter, when demand is lower and rates are often cheaper. Our moving discounts guide shows you how.

How long does a move from Bridgeport to Lansing take?

The 737-mile move from Bridgeport, CT, to Lansing, , takes one to six days. Some Bridgeport movers may offer expedited moving if you need it faster. If you need more time, ask your mover about storage options in Lansing.
